Ranking locally without citations??? ABSO-FUCKING-LUTELY

Citations do help give those nice clean links that you can use as tier 1's as they age.

However using a "FAKE" address will still work really well IF you can receive the code sent to the location.

Locally is by far the easiest area to rank.

Step 1. PBN links - hopefully your own.
Step 2. Citations - pretty easy
Step 3. Basic Social Setup
Step 4. You've now ranked 90% of local unless it's loan/lawyers

Yes, it is possible to rank on the 7-pack using a fake address.
 
The die-hard map spammers never mail verify. They always phone verify.

There's 1 crazy mfkr I follow all the time. One of very few people I follow on twitter and The Guardian recently did a story on him. He goes by the name "maptivists" on twitter and stole a listing from the secret service. On top of that, he verified an address out in the middle of a lake. Steals peoples listings and renames them "lol... google ur my bit.ch". You can check out his latest stunts here: https://twitter.com/maptivists/status/440775367477850112

Also, Linda from Catalyst EMarketing, the lady with the forum about G local, she has an awesome post about map spamming. I got that bookmarked somewhere and it shows you some of the shit map spammers do to create fake listings with fake addresses.

So to answer your questions -

1) Yes you can't rank with a fake address. I have multiple listings like that ranking right now.
2) Yes you can rank without an address on the site.

I have done both. The only thing I'd disagree with is it being "easy". That's completely relevant to the industry and there are thousands of competitive local niches far more ruthless than lawyers and loans.
